http://www.drf.com/drfPDFChartRacesI...=20090711&RN=8

1 Pocket Cowboys Nicol P A Jr 121 14.60 5.40 3.90
2 Slevin Davila J R Jr 117 4.90 2.90
4 Uncle T Seven Rodriguez P A 121 3.50

Times in 5ths: :24 :483 1:123 1:382 1:45
Times in 100ths: :24.18 :48.63 1:12.60 1:38.41 1:45.12

Also ran: Legal Consent, Longing for Malibu and Momsboy

Winning Trainer: Schwartz Scott M - Owner: Schwartz Scott M.

$2 Exacta (1-2) Paid $57.00
$2 Trifecta (1-2-4) Paid $203.50
